How they compare
Belarus currently reports 183,219 number against 166,569 number in Dominican Republic, a difference of 16,650 number.
That makes Belarus's figure about 1.1 times Dominican Republic's.
Across all 19 years both countries report, Belarus has been ahead every year.
Belarus ranks 64th and Dominican Republic ranks 66th of 196 countries.
Belarus has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
Total number of male students enrolled in public and private pre-primary education institutions (ISCED 0.2) regardless of age. Within ISCED 0, early childhood educational development programmes are targeted at children aged 0 to 2 years; and pre-primary education programmes are targeted at children aged 3 years until the age to start ISCED 1.
